Cloud Engineer
Cluj-Napoca, Romania & Bucharest, Romania Technology Job ID R15744Who We Are – MassMutual Romania
MassMutual Romania – in partnership with MassMutual in the United States – will help shape a culture of innovation and to create the digital products and technology solutions that help people secure their future and protect the ones they love. Positioning MassMutual for its next 20 million customers and remaining innovative in a digital-first world led to the creation of MassMutual Romania in 2020. With offices in Bucharest and Cluj, MassMutual Romania was established to build an in-house team with expertise in application development and support, quality assurance and data science. For 170 years, MassMutual has put its customers at the heart of what it does by providing holistic financial solutions, guidance, and education on their terms. Its long-term strategy helps ensure that policyowners and their loved ones can rely on them to be there when they need them most. If this vision excites you, come join us and become a MassMutual Romania team member. This is a great opportunity to be part of the transformational journey at MassMutual Romania. As we continue to grow our business and look for new ways to engage with customers, technology will be one of the most important enablers to our success and you can be a part of it.
The Opportunity
Do you want to be part of a team that encourages your growth, supports your ambitions, and makes it a priority for you to reach your goals? Is helping people part of who you are? At MassMutual Romania, we help millions of people find financial freedom, offer financial protection and plan for the future. We do this by building trust with our customers by being knowledgeable problem solvers and prioritize their needs above all else. We Live Mutual. If this sounds like a fit, come join our team.
The Opportunity
Do you want to be part of a team that encourages your growth, supports your ambitions and makes it a priority for you to reach your goals? Is helping people part of who you are? Our Cloud Platform Engineering team that is positioned at the root of Cloud enabling solutions development is looking to expand in Bucharest and Cluj.
Job Description
The Cloud Engineer will work from home, our Bucharest or Cluj offices, or from any other place considered suitable for a working environment. The person who will join this role will report to an IT Delivery Manager from Romania.
As a Cloud Engineer of the Cloud Platform Engineering team you will play a crucial role in architecting and implementing fully automated, secure, reliable, scalable & resilient multi-cloud/hybrid-cloud solutions. The Cloud Engineer will be part of a highly technical and cross functional team and work closely with cloud/DevOps engineers, platform delivery lead, solution architects, enterprise architects and other stakeholders. The ideal candidate for this role is a self-starter who can work independently with minimal oversight, has an agile/DevOps mindset and is eager to learn.
Meet The Team
We are passionate Engineers in a small but efficient team spread across US, Romania and India. Our mission is to ensure the patterns designed by architecture teams are implemented across the entire organization in a standardized and automated manner.
In our day to day work, we manage the tools used by our entire organization like Jenkins, Artifactory, Vault. We also offer support for our internal clients kubernetes clusters
From time to time we’re writing some python scripts, terraform code to automate the manual processes.
Our mindset and strategy is to build and deliver one click products.
We’re tracking all our work in Jira and Confluence, following the Kanban Agile methodology.
Responsibilities
Technical Design, Development & Problem Solving:
Provide recommendations on architectural changes in order to improve efficiency, reliability and performance and to reduce cost
Explore and recommend new technologies/services. Articulate the advantages of various solution options
Define platform software engineering standards and ensure compliance
Ability to independently develop algorithms and deliver results in production environments at scale.
Ability to take on proof of concepts to proof new technologies
Problem solve with little to no guidance
Collaborate with Cloud/DevOps engineers to solve technical and design problems
Conduct and oversee design & code reviews
Execution & Delivery:
Ability to independently execute complex, long term projects
Understand context of the work rather than just focusing on what is assigned.
Excellent communicator and collaborates well with people inside the team and in other organizations
Innovate and is open to ideas to improve efficiency and works with the team to pivot if necessary.
Write clean, high-performance, well tested infrastructure code with a focus on reusability and automation (e.g. Shell, Python, Golang, Puppet, Terraform etc...)
Software Engineering Excellence:
Responsible for code excellence and quality of the project being assigned
Research on tools being used by the department and provide suggestions for improvements
Creates reusable code frameworks or example projects to aid developers on the team.
Advocates and leads initiatives for enhancing our testing frameworks
Leadership (only for FTE):
Mentor core developers
Partner with business stakeholders and product managers to define project timelines and deliverable at each project stage.
Awareness and involvement in identifying the resources which would be required for project delivery.
Being able to identify resources from other departments.
Requirements
Bachelor's Degree in Computer Science or equivalent
Advanced understanding of CI / CD concepts
Experience with Jenkins (e.g. master-slave architecture, Jenkins Shared Libraries, Groovy)
Experience with artifact repository managers (Artifactory is preferred)
Understanding of Docker containers
Good scripting skills (e.g. bash, python, go lang)
Practical experience with version control systems (Git is preferred)
Seasoned Infrastructure as Code developer with Terraform
Hands-on experience with Kubernetes
Understanding of microservices architecture
Hands-on experience on public cloud
Strong written and verbal communication skills
Able to thrive in a collaborative and cross-functional environment
Familiar with Agile methodology concepts
Nice to have:
Understanding of GitOps processes and tools
Experience with DevOps concepts, tools (e.g. Artifactory, Helm, Ansible, etc.) and emerging technologies
Experience with Github and Github Actions
#LI-DC2
Jobs Like This One
- Java Software Engineer (API & Streaming) Bucharest, Romania
- Cloud Engineer (Azure) Bucharest, Romania
- Workday Integration Developer (Barings) Bucharest, Romania
- Cloud Operations Engineer (Barings) Bucharest, Romania
- Cloud Database Administrator (Barings) Bucharest, Romania
About MassMutual®
MassMutual Romania – in partnership with MassMutual in the United States – will help shape a culture of innovation and create the digital products and technology solutions that help people secure their future and protect the ones they love.
Positioning MassMutual for its next 20 million customers and remaining innovative in a digital-first world led to the creation of MassMutual Romania in 2020. With offices in Bucharest and Cluj, MassMutual Romania was established to build an in-house team with expertise in application development and support, quality assurance and data science.
For more than 170 years, MassMutual has put its customers at the heart of what it does by providing holistic financial solutions, guidance, and education on their terms. Its long-term strategy helps ensure that policyowners and their loved ones can rely on them to be there when they need them most.